Vertex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2024FY 2023FY 2022FY 2021FY 2020
Period EndingD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Valuation Ratios
Forward P/E82.2255.4943.8559.51151.59
P/S Ratio12.487.234.435.5513.59
P/B Ratio46.3916.359.4810.2622.20
Price/Tangible Book36.89
Price/FCF84.00165.03118.8640.31131.95
Price/OCF50.4855.6634.1026.1585.51
PEG Ratio7.673.2010.69
Enterprise Value Ratios
EV/Revenue12.587.254.425.5112.87
EV/EBITDA322.312163.03295.08221.81
EV/EBIT445.032048.61
EV/FCF84.67165.48118.7240.01124.99
Profitability & Returns
Return on Equity (ROE)-0.24%-0.05%-0.05%-0.01%-1.51%
Return on Assets (ROA)0.01%-0.01%0.00%0.00%-0.16%
Return on Invested Capital (ROIC)-2.22%-0.03%-0.02%0.02%
Return on Capital Employed (ROCE)0.03%-0.02%-0.01%0.00%-0.39%
Leverage & Solvency Ratios
Debt/Equity1.960.270.320.120.01
Debt/EBITDA11.8511.286.631.86
Debt/FCF3.552.674.010.490.03
Liquidity Ratios
Current Ratio1.000.600.600.531.38
Quick Ratio0.870.500.510.411.30
Efficiency Ratios
Asset Turnover0.690.770.710.690.91
Yield & Distribution Ratios
Earnings Yield-0.01%0.00%-0.01%0.00%-0.01%
FCF Yield0.01%0.01%0.01%0.02%0.01%
Buyback Yield-0.02%-0.01%-0.01%-0.12%-0.09%